John Eldon Hendricks

March 25, 1933 ~ November 25, 2018 (age 85) 85 Years Old

Tribute

John Eldon Hendricks was born in Batavia, New York on March 25, 1933, to Fred and Melva Hendricks.  He was the youngest of 9 children.

After graduating from high school, he put himself through school by working at a funeral home. He graduated from Greenville College in 1954.  He attended Asbury Seminary and received both his Master of Arts and Doctor of Ministry from California Graduate School of Theology.  He also received an honorary Doctor of Divinity from Spring Arbor College.

He met and married the love of his life, Bobbie, in 1956, and they quickly accepted the call into ministry serving first as youth pastor in Dearborn, Michigan then as Senior Pastor in Ypsilanti, Michigan; St. Petersburg, FL; Spring Arbor, MI; Greenville, IL and Lakeland, FL. 

He loved people and never met a stranger. With a beautiful tenor voice, he traveled in a men’s quartet during college and the love of music stayed with him for life especially quartet music and hymns.  There wasn’t a hymn he didn’t know, and he could sing every verse by heart.

He was kind, caring and compassionate. He was a gifted writer, speaker and master of alliteration.  He had the ability to make the Word of God come alive as he shared deep truths from its scriptures.  He retired from full-time ministry at age 80 after faithfully serving as a pastor in the Free Methodist Church for 58 years.

He was a loving husband, father, grandfather and friend to many.  His faith became sight when he went to be with the Lord on Sunday, November 25, 2018.
